Output 257d3512a507c171aab1516bef6c492a660f386f4800707cce60d1bbf191a90e:0

value
1597028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ee8bc5ce85437975806452d7973fd6ebc873e00d OP_EQUAL
address
3PSLBmwUGAaFT1dp88ZvDvRUFKx9G2XtxS
transaction
257d3512a507c171aab1516bef6c492a660f386f4800707cce60d1bbf191a90e
spent
true